CNN Central News & Network–ITDC India Epress/ITDC News Bhopal: A two-day academic and cultural programme, “Vidyarangam 2025,” was organized by the School of Banking, Finance and Commerce at Scope Global Skills University, Bhopal. The objective of the programme was to promote the holistic development of students by encouraging cultural and creative abilities alongside academic learning.

The event was graced by the presence of the University Chancellor Dr. Siddharth Chaturvedi, Vice-Chancellor Dr. Vijay Singh, Registrar Dr. Sitesh Kumar Sinha, TNP Head Dheeraj Prasad, Head of Management School Dr. Kumar Siddharth, Head of Banking, Finance and Commerce Dr. Neeta Vaidande, and Dean Student Welfare Dr. Vinod Sharma.

On the first day, an academic quiz competition titled “Logomania” was conducted, followed by an energetic dance competition “Sanskriti Vibes,” which beautifully showcased cultural diversity and creative expression. Dr. Jyotsna Mishra served as the judge for these competitions.

On this occasion, Dean Student Welfare Dr. Vinod Sharma encouraged students to develop multidimensional skills for their overall growth.

The second day commenced with a thought-provoking debate competition “Talent Buzz,” judged by Dr. Shravani Sundarasan, Head of School, Department of Humanities. In the second session, a melodious singing competition “Kala Pulse” was organized, with Dr. Meenakshi Dayal and Dr. Pooja Bijlani, Head of the Department of Future Skills, serving as judges.

Following the singing competition, a fashion show based on the theme “Unity in Diversity” was presented, conveying a powerful message of the nation’s cultural unity and harmony.
